fn sanitize_request_url(mut url: Url) -> Url {
let _ = url.set_username("");
let _ = url.set_password(None);
url.set_fragment(None);
let retained = url
.query_pairs()
.filter(|(key, _)| !sensitive_query_key(key))
.map(|(key, value)| (key.into_owned(), value.into_owned()))
.collect::<Vec<_>>();
url.set_query(None);
if !retained.is_empty() {
url.query_pairs_mut().extend_pairs(retained);
}
url
}
fn sensitive_query_key(key: &str) -> bool {
matches!(
key.to_ascii_lowercase().replace('-', "_").as_str(),
"access_token"
| "api_key"
| "apikey"
| "auth"
| "authorization"
| "cookie"
| "credential"
| "id_token"
| "key"
| "password"
| "passwd"
| "refresh_token"
| "secret"
| "session"
| "sessionid"
| "sig"
| "signature"
| "token"
| "x_amz_credential"
| "x_amz_security_token"
| "x_amz_signature"
| "x_goog_credential"
| "x_goog_signature"
)
}

fn validate_url_target(url: &Url) -> std::result::Result<(), String> {
if !matches!(url.scheme(), "http" | "https") {
return Err("URL must start with http:// or https://".to_string());
}
let serialized_host = url
.host_str()
.ok_or_else(|| "URL must include a host".to_string())?;
let host = serialized_host
.strip_prefix('[')
.and_then(|host| host.strip_suffix(']'))
.unwrap_or(serialized_host);
let normalized_host = host.trim_end_matches('.').to_ascii_lowercase();
if normalized_host == "localhost" || normalized_host.ends_with(".localhost") {
return Err("URL host is not publicly routable".to_string());
}
if let Ok(address) = host.parse::<IpAddr>() {
if is_forbidden_ip(address) {
return Err(format!(
"URL resolves to a non-public address and was blocked: {}",
address
));
}
}
Ok(())
}
fn validate_resolved_addresses(
host: &str,
addresses: &[SocketAddr],
) -> std::result::Result<(), String> {
if addresses.is_empty() {
return Err(format!("URL host did not resolve to an address: {}", host));
}
if let Some(address) = addresses
.iter()
.map(SocketAddr::ip)
.find(|address| is_forbidden_ip(*address))
{
return Err(format!(
"URL host {} resolves to a non-public address and was blocked: {}",
host, address
));
}
Ok(())
}
fn is_forbidden_ip(address: IpAddr) -> bool {
match address {
IpAddr::V4(address) => is_forbidden_ipv4(address),
IpAddr::V6(address) => is_forbidden_ipv6(address),
}
}
fn is_forbidden_ipv4(address: Ipv4Addr) -> bool {
let [a, b, c, _] = address.octets();
a == 0
|| a == 10
|| (a == 100 && (64..=127).contains(&b)) || a == 127
|| (a == 169 && b == 254) || (a == 172 && (16..=31).contains(&b))
|| (a == 192 && b == 0 && c == 0) || (a == 192 && b == 0 && c == 2) || (a == 192 && b == 88 && c == 99) || (a == 192 && b == 168)
|| (a == 198 && (b == 18 || b == 19)) || (a == 198 && b == 51 && c == 100) || (a == 203 && b == 0 && c == 113) || a >= 224 }
fn is_forbidden_ipv6(address: Ipv6Addr) -> bool {
if let Some(mapped_v4) = address.to_ipv4() {
return is_forbidden_ipv4(mapped_v4);
}
let segments = address.segments();
address.is_unspecified()
|| address.is_loopback()
|| address.is_multicast()
|| (segments[0] & 0xfe00) == 0xfc00 || (segments[0] & 0xffc0) == 0xfe80 || (segments[0] & 0xffc0) == 0xfec0 || (segments[0] == 0x0064 && segments[1] == 0xff9b) || (segments[0] == 0x0100 && segments[1..4] == [0, 0, 0]) || (segments[0] == 0x2001 && segments[1] == 0x0000) || (segments[0] == 0x2001 && segments[1] == 0x0db8) || segments[0] == 0x2002 || (segments[0] & 0xfff0) == 0x3ff0 }
